What are probiotics?
Probiotics are live microorganisms—often called beneficial bacteria—that help maintain a healthy balance of gut microbes and support the gut barrier.

How probiotics support immune function
Did you know that a large portion of the immune system's cells are active in the gut microbiome?1 This means that a healthy gut microbiome correlates with a healthy immune function. Probiotics are usually taken to address the former, but in doing so, they help the latter.
Here’s a little more about how probiotics help with immune function:
- They support the gut barrier: Probiotics help support the integrity of the intestinal lining, which plays a role in the body's natural defense processes.2
- They support immune signaling: As one review article puts it, “Probiotic bacteria can interact with intestinal immune cells and commensal microflora to support immune functions.”3 In other words, probiotics interact with immune cells in the gut to help support immune responses.
- They shape immune memory and tolerance: Recent scientific reviews show that a properly functioning gut microbiota plays a key role in supporting immune system tolerance and appropriate immune responses.4
Together, these probiotic-assisted actions help the immune system do its job without added gut-related stress. Basically, probiotics support immune system health by doing what they do best: supporting the gut.
Top probiotic strains for immune health
There’s no specific “immune support probiotic”. Benefits are often strain-specific, and their effectiveness can vary for each individual and your unique health.
Keep this in mind:
- Not all probiotics are the same: different strains target different digestive concerns. You might want to speak with your doctor about what’s best for you.
- Choose research-backed probiotics and pair them with prebiotics to aim for the best gut health results. (Prebiotics feed beneficial bacteria, helping probiotics work more effectively, sustaining long-term gut health.)
- A diet that includes fermented foods (like yogurt, kefir, sauerkraut, and kimchi) provides diverse microbes.

Here are some tips for adding probiotics to your meals:
- Eat fermented foods regularly. Many everyday foods contain live beneficial microbes, such as:
- Yogurt
- Kefir
- Sauerkraut and kimchi
- Miso and tempeh
- Kombucha
Aim to eat moderate and consistent servings of some of these throughout your week. Need ideas? Turn to yogurt for breakfast or a daily snack. Enjoy some kefir in the morning—balance its tart taste with bitter coffee, or vice versa—and pursue the occasional sauerkraut on a sandwich. Order miso soup with your sushi. And if it’s ever available, opt for kombucha instead of a soda or cocktail.
- Consider probiotic supplements. These can be helpful when your diet lacks fermented foods, when you’re traveling and don’t have access to probiotic-filled foods (and/or are consuming other gut-stressors), or are recovering from antibiotics.
- Feed probiotics with prebiotics. Probiotics thrive when paired with prebiotics, which are found in many foods, especially onions, garlic, leeks, bananas, oats, asparagus, and legumes. (This is why AG1’s formula contains prebiotics alongside probiotics.)
